The Details That Made It Theirs
Right from the getting-ready coverage, it was clear this wedding was going to be full of beautiful, considered details. Personalised wax seal favours, pearl jewellery, a "Bride" keepsake box, soft white and blush florals — everything had been chosen with real care and intention.
And then there was the dress. Danielle wore a bespoke, one-of-a-kind gown with the most beautiful draped cowl back I think I've ever photographed. It was elegant, modern and completely unique — because it was made just for her. In the soft light of Walworth's interior rooms, that dress was simply extraordinary.

The Magician, the Drinks Reception and the Sunshine
A drinks reception at Walworth in May sunshine is a genuine treat. Guests spilled out onto the grounds, and Danielle and Dan had booked the magician Luke Howells, to keep everyone entertained — including, memorably, a trick involving plumbing that absolutely had the crowd baffled and delighted in equal measure. There's always something special about watching wedding guests completely lose their minds over a magic trick. The laughter during that hour was something else.
Golden Hour in the Grounds
When the evening light came, we headed out into Walworth's beautiful grounds and the photographs practically made themselves. Danielle and Dan under the ancient trees, that golden light filtering through the canopy, the gazebo in the background — quietly romantic, completely natural. This is why I love this venue so much in late spring. The grounds at golden hour are simply breathtaking.
The bridesmaids in their dusky pink dresses alongside Danielle's ivory gown made for the most beautiful group portraits too — that soft, warm palette was perfect against the stone and greenery of the castle grounds.
